Gary serves Cal Maritime as the Engine Company Officer and Associate Director of the
Edwards Leadership Development Program,
Gary is 20 year career Naval Officer bringing a wide variety leadership experience as a
Naval Special Warfare Officer, Surface Warfare Officer and Senior Explosive Ordnance
Officer. Some of his previous leadership positions include Explosive Ordnance Mobile
Unit Executive Officer as well as Executive Officer of the USS Implicit MSO 455. He
qualified as Navy Ships Navigator, Underway Officer of the Deck and Engineering Officer
of the Watch.
Following his Navy Career he held positions as Senior Management Consultant with Booz
Allen Hamilton, launched his own management consulting practice, and served as a Career
Management Consultant for several boutique career management consulting and coaching
firms. Additionally, he held a position as the Director of Career Services for a
San Diego based career college. Most recently was an acting Managing Consultant for
a Life Science Consulting Firm.
Gary in the past as served as an adjunct professor for both National University and San
Diego State College teaching a wide range of courses in Leadership and Consulting.
He is also a certified facilitator through the Navy, Department of Defense and the
Stephen Covey Leadership Institute.
Gary holds an MA with a concentration in Management/Organizational Excellence from the
University of Redlands and a BS in Oceanography from the United States Naval Academy.
Gary served during Operations Desert Shield and Desert Storm in addition to making a deployment
with Underwater Demolition Team ELEVEN being the 1st United States forces to land
on Iwo Jima since World War II.
His awards and decorations include the Meritorious Service Medal, Navy Commendation
Medal and Navy Achievement Medal.
